There is an issue we're aware of whereby sackings during challenges are sometimes not processed at the correct time and happen during the season update instead - this is something that we've got under review internally.
When running the Injury Crisis or Unrest at Home challenges, a board expectation should be generated based on both the club's starting position and the expected performance of the club. Meeting this expectation is supposed to decide whether you get sacked before the end of the season or not. If you've been given a wildly unrealistic expectation based on a very low starting position, it's something we'd definitely be interested to look into.
